How much does it cost to acquire a customer in the consumer / lemon law industry?

For consumer / lemon law businesses, customer acquisition cost (CAC) typically runs $300–$3,500, with a mid-market figure around $1,000. What is a typical customer lifetime value (LTV) for a consumer / lemon law business?

Average LTV for consumer / lemon law businesses is roughly $5,000–$90,000, which against typical CAC gives an LTV:CAC ratio near 20.0:1 (3:1 or higher is considered healthy). Typical gross margins run 55-75%. ZOE estimates where you sit versus the local market.

What is a healthy profit margin for a consumer / lemon law business?

Gross margins for consumer / lemon law businesses typically fall in the 55-75% range. Net margin is usually lower after marketing, rent, and labour — ZOE helps you find where competitors are winning on price, volume, or positioning.

How long does it take a consumer / lemon law business to break even?

A typical consumer / lemon law business reaches break-even in about 6-18 months, on a typical startup investment of $20K-$150K. Faster review growth and search visibility — the things ZOE tracks — are among the biggest levers on that timeline.
